Magnetic drive pumps set the standard
Magnetic drive pumps manufactured by CDR Pumps ensure hydrogen peroxide is kept totally contained at all times for optimum operator and environmental safety at Brenntag's new facility.
Brenntag (UK), the European chemical distributor with facilities in Kingswinford, and central distribution centre based in Lutterworth, Leicestershire, has recently installed a new hydrogen peroxide storage and packaging facility to ensure the company is totally flexible to meet its customers demands and requirements.
The facility, which comprises two bulk storage tanks, is fully automated, and at the heart of the system sit magnetic drive pumps manufactured by CDR Pumps, which ensure product is kept totally contained at all times for optimum operator and environmental safety.
Brenntag (UK) has made the decision to replace all the pumps on site to CDR units, and with the help of a replacement incentive offered by CDR, can do so in a very cost effective manner.
The very nature of Brenntag's business is that of the safe handling and distribution of very aggressive chemicals to industry.
Safety is of course of paramount importance, and after many months heavy trialing of the CDR magnetic drive pump ranges, it was decided that they would be the standard pump used on site.
